Pediatric Hospitalist APN
The Pediatric Hospitalist APN utilizes a patient-centered coordinated care model, demonstrating competencies in leadership, direct clinical practice, consultation/collaboration, coaching/guiding, research, and ethical decision-making. The APN works collaboratively with the practice/hospital team to assess, plan, and implement care for individuals with health and safety needs. Seeking an experienced pediatric acute care certified advanced practice nurse.
Schedule is a mix of 8, 10 and 12 hours shifts, 3-4 times a week. During the weekdays, there are 2 shifts: 6am-4pm; 3pm - 11pm and the weekend shifts are 7am-7pm, every 3rd weekend.
Responsibilities
- Performs and documents accurate, complete, and relevant history and physical assessments appropriate for the patient's age, gender, and clinical problem.
- Orders, performs, and interprets laboratory tests and diagnostic studies/procedures in collaboration with physicians and consultants as appropriate.
- Manages general medical and surgical conditions based on comprehensive knowledge of etiologies, risk factors, pathophysiology, and the indications and contraindications of pharmacologic agents and other treatment modalities.
- Prescribes medication safely and effectively in accordance with best practices, hospital policy, and NJ regulations, providing patient education as needed.
